Join a Transformative Technology LeaderPalantir Technologies is redefining how organizations utilize data for impactful decision-making and operational efficiency. By connecting critical data to those who need it most, our innovative platforms empower partners across various sectors to create life-saving solutions, anticipate supply chain challenges, locate missing persons, and much more.Position OverviewAs a Forward Deployed Software Engineer (FDSE), you will engage directly with clients to deeply understand their challenges and architect data-driven solutions. Our clients depend on Palantir’s cutting-edge platforms for their most crucial operations. Projects often begin with probing questions such as, “What is causing our flight delays?” or “How can we enhance our detection of money laundering?” In this role, you will leverage your problem-solving acumen, creativity, and technical expertise to help organizations harness their data for meaningful impact. You will gain invaluable insights and contribute to significant projects within some of the world's most pivotal industries.In the FDSE role, your responsibilities will mirror those of a Chief Technology Officer in a startup environment: you will collaborate in small teams with autonomy and ownership over the execution of high-stakes projects. Your day may involve architectural discussions with fellow engineers, managing large-scale data sets, developing custom web applications, engaging with customer executives, or defining team strategies.If you aspire to become a leader in technology or an entrepreneur, Palantir offers an unparalleled environment to cultivate these skills. You will learn how to dissect complex problems and understand the implications of various solutions. You will be exposed to new technologies and programming languages, potentially even contributing to their development. You will work independently while being supported by a community that will inspire and challenge your growth.

Talentspoc LLC is hiring an Internal Medicine Physician for its Abu Dhabi team. This position centers on delivering comprehensive care to adults, including diagnosis, treatment, and prevention of a wide range of medical conditions. Role overview The Internal Medicine Physician will care for adults facing both acute and chronic health issues. The role includes supporting preventive health measures and collaborating with other healthcare professionals to improve patient outcomes. Main responsibilities Gather detailed patient histories and perform thorough physical examinations to support accurate diagnoses. Develop and manage individualized treatment plans for each patient. Oversee ongoing care for chronic illnesses and address urgent medical needs as they occur. Educate patients on preventive health measures and recommended lifestyle changes. Work closely with specialists and other healthcare staff to coordinate patient care. Maintain precise, current medical records for all patients. Stay informed about advances in internal medicine and incorporate new practices as appropriate. Take part in community health initiatives and educational outreach activities.
